Victorian Period Precious Jewelry



The attraction of Victorian Age fashion jewelry lies in its intricate workmanship and extensive meaning, showing the societal values and psychological currents of the moment. Covering from 1837 to 1901, this period was identified by an attraction with nature, mourning, and romanticism, which profoundly affected precious jewelry style. Jewelry items usually included fancy motifs, such as blossoms, animals, and intricate lattice job, crafted from materials like gold, silver, and gems.

One remarkable aspect of Victorian fashion jewelry is its nostalgic worth. Many pieces were created to share deep emotions, functioning as symbols of love or remembrance. For circumstances, grieving precious jewelry, adorned with black enamel or hair inlays, served to honor shed enjoyed ones, embodying the period's preoccupation with death and the immortality.




Additionally, the technical innovations of the Industrial Transformation enabled for more intricate styles and the use of new products, such as rubies and pearls. This democratization of deluxe made jewelry more easily accessible to the middle course, causing an expansion of varied designs. Overall, Victorian Period fashion jewelry remains an exciting testament to the intricate interplay of art, feeling, and societal standards during a transformative historic period.


Art Nouveau Creations



Identified by its organic forms and streaming lines, Art Nouveau jewelry arised in the late 19th and early 20th centuries as an action to the mass production and inflexible styles of the coming before eras. This creative movement sought to welcome nature, incorporating components such as flowers, leaves, and creeping plants into the styles. Art Nouveau items typically included asymmetrical structures, stressing a sense of motion and fluidness.

Crafted primarily from products like gold, silver, and enamel, Art Nouveau precious jewelry showcased detailed workmanship and interest to detail. Notable artisans, such as René Lalique and Alphonse Mucha, played crucial duties in promoting this style, creating stunning items that highlighted the appeal of natural motifs. Gems were usually made use of sparingly, allowing the total style to take spotlight.





Using cutting-edge methods, such as enameling and the incorporation of glass, more recognized Art Nouveau jewelry from its precursors. The movement inevitably celebrated originality and creative expression, making each item a special work of art. Edwardian Period Pieces



Throughout the early 20th century, the Edwardian duration observed an amazing advancement in jewelry layout, noted by an emphasis on sophistication and opulence. This age, called after King Edward VII, extended from 1901 to 1910 and is characterized by the complex workmanship and delicate appearances that define its pieces.


Precious jewelry from this duration frequently includes platinum setups, a material that enabled finer and even more detailed styles, improving the play of light versus the treasures. The usage of diamonds was prevalent, commonly prepared in fancy themes such as lacework and flower patterns. Edwardian precious jewelry also embraced using pearls, which added a soft, luminous quality to the pieces.


Breastpins, pendants, and earrings became prominent, showcasing the era's propensity for enchanting and wayward styles. In general, Edwardian period precious jewelry continues to be a testimony to a time when creativity and elegance ruled supreme in the globe of adornment.

Art Deco Designs



Emerging in the 1920s and prospering through the 1930s, Art Deco creates stand for a bold departure from the luxuriant designs of previous eras, accepting geometric forms, structured forms, and dynamic shades. Identified by a sense of modernity, this design motion attracted inspiration from various sources, including cubism, old Egyptian concepts, and the vibrant visual appeals of the maker age.


Art Deco precious jewelry frequently features strong contrasts, integrating products such as platinum, gold, and tinted gems to develop striking aesthetic results. Making use of elaborate patterns and themes, including zigzags, chevrons, and floral aspects, showcases the workmanship of the moment. Especially, the era also saw the introduction of new methods such as enamel job and using artificial rocks, increasing the opportunities for creative expression.


Pieces from this duration often exhibit glamour and elegance, making them extremely looked for after by enthusiasts and enthusiasts alike. Art Deco jewelry serves not only as a reflection of its time but also as a testament to the enduring charm of its ingenious designs.
